Pam Cakes With Buttered Honey Syrup
Southern living
Steps
Pancakes: combine the flour and next 4 ingredients in a bowl.
In another bowl , whisk the buttermilk and eggs together.
Gradually stir egg mixture into the flour mixture.
Gently stir in the butter.
Pour about 1 / 4 cup batter for each pancake onto a hot buttered griddle or large nonstick skillet.
Cook pancakes 3-4 minutes or until tops are covered with bubbles and edges look dry and cooked.
Turn and cook 3-4 minutes or until golden brown.
Place pancakes in a single layer on a baking sheet , and keep warm in a 200 oven up to 30 minutes.
Buttered honey syrup: do not make this ahead of time.
Heated honey will crystallize when cooled and will not melt if reheated.
Melt butter in a small saucepan over med-low heat.
Stir in 1 / 2 cup honey and cook 1 minute or until warm.
Drizzle over pancakes.
Ingredients
all-purpose fl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, buttermilk, eggs, butter, honey
